Early Elton John/Bernie Taupin : Love Song
This is their first album - full of Taupin's love of America, but without any of Elton's subsequent glam, or rock.
The playing is clean and acoustic - the songs spare and evocative, the harmonies affecting and unforced.
You're left wondering - why throw all this away?
Miles Davis - Ascenseur a l'Echafaud (Lift to the Scaffold)
Miles Davis recorded this live in an improvised studio, in '58, as the film was being made. Jeanne Moreau set up a bar and after each day's shoot, sat in on the session and served the band drinks. It was Louis Malle's first film.
